HostGator has grown into one of the largest web hosting companies, hosting over 400,000 clients around the world.
- The company was started in 2002
- Head offices are located in Houston and Austin, Texas
- They employ 450 helpful people.
- 4.7 million domains are hosted with Hostgator
- Hurrah for great support 24/7 Live Support via phone, chats, email
- You get their 99.9% “Uptime” Guarantee
- You get a 45-day money back guarantee
- Hostgator is powered by Wind Energy (through Renewable Energy Credits to offset emissions)
- Named 21st Fastest Growing Company on the Inc. 5000
